CCoouunnttiinngg LLiikkee CCooiinnss

Count the value of each set of coins.

1. What is the value of 8 pennies? __________¢

2. What is the value of 4 nickels? __________¢

3. What is the value of 6 dimes? __________¢

4. What is the value of 2 quarters? __________¢
